Differences
This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ision Next revision Both sides next revision | ||
devel:documentation:quickstart:dev:ide:eclipse [2019/06/14 09:12] doischert [Metamodel generation] |
devel:documentation:quickstart:dev:ide:eclipse [2019/08/29 14:01] hanakp |
||
---|---|---|---|
Line 69: | Line 69: | ||
* rpt-impl | * rpt-impl | ||
- | This setup has to be done for modules **core-api**, | + | This setup has to be done for modules **core-api**, |
**Note:** If you don't set metamodel generation, you will see Java problems like '' | **Note:** If you don't set metamodel generation, you will see Java problems like '' | ||
Line 139: | Line 139: | ||
</ | </ | ||
+ | Another possible issue may be an exception like this one: | ||
+ | < | ||
+ | java.util.concurrent.ExecutionException: | ||
+ | Caused by: org.apache.catalina.LifecycleException: | ||
+ | at org.apache.catalina.util.L | ||
+ | Caused by: org.springframework.beans.factory.BeanDefinitionStoreException: | ||
+ | at org.springframework.context.annotation.ConfigurationClassParser.parse(ConfigurationClassParser.java: | ||
+ | </ | ||
+ | |||
+ | If you see this, make sure that | ||
+ | * you have the project idm-core-test-api open | ||
+ | * in Properties of the idm-core-impl (or any problematic project), check Java Build Path and make sure that each test folder has the Output folder set to test-classes. See below: |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| If you have a problem in not being able to Add and Remove, try to open idm-app, look at Properties, Project Facets and check you have the correct version of Java: | ||
+ | {{ : | ||
===== Update project after pulling new version ===== | ===== Update project after pulling new version ===== | ||
Line 207: | Line 224: | ||
By standard Maven build I mean running '' | By standard Maven build I mean running '' | ||
+ | |||
+ | ===== Stucked Eclipse settings ===== | ||
+ | |||
+ | If the error you see during the build is not one of frequently known, you can try deleting " | ||
+ | Best way to restart module settings is to delete problematic module, then do Project -> clean and then delete the " | ||
+ |